Displaying the Hosts List
To display the IGMP Hosts List, do the following:
1. Select the Switching tab.
The Switching tab is displayed. See Figure 19 on page 58.
2. From the Switching tab, select IGMP.
The IGMP Snooping page is displayed with the Configuration tab
selected by default. See Figure 49 on page 147.
3. Click the Hosts List tab.
The Hosts List page is displayed. See Figure 51.
Figure 51. IGMP Snooping Page with Hosts List Tab
The following settings are displayed:
Group Address— Indicates the multicast addresses of the
groups.
VLAN ID— Indicates the VLAN ID of the host nodes.
Port ID— Specifies the ports of the host nodes. If the host nodes
are on port trunks, this field displays the trunk ID numbers instead
of the port numbers.
Host IP— Specifies the IP addresses of the host nodes.
